Unconditional Waiver And Release Upon Final Payment With Notary

What is unconditional waiver and release upon final payment with notary?

Unconditional waiver and release upon final payment with notary is a legal document that effectively releases the claimant's right to a lien or claim on a property or project upon receiving the final payment. This document is notarized to ensure its authenticity and enforceability.

How to complete unconditional waiver and release upon final payment with notary

Completing an unconditional waiver and release upon final payment with notary is a straightforward process. Here are the steps to follow:

01
Obtain the necessary unconditional waiver and release upon final payment with notary form.
02
Fill out the form with the required information, including the claimant's name, the property/project details, and the date of final payment.
03
Review the completed form for accuracy and completeness.
04
Sign the form in the presence of a notary public.
05
Have the notary public notarize the document by affixing their seal and signature.
06
Keep a copy of the completed and notarized form for your records.
07
Provide the original notarized form to the appropriate party, such as the property owner or general contractor.
